Indexed annuities are not tax-exempt, but they are tax-deferred. That means you dont pay taxes on the money you put into the annuity until you start making withdrawals. Withdrawals are taxed as ordinary income. Many people are unaware that there are two types of indexed annuities-qualified and non-qualified.
A fixed indexed annuity is a tax-deferred, long-term savings option that provides principal protection in a down market and opportunity for growth. It gives you more growth potential than a fixed annuity along with less risk and less potential return than a variable annuity.
With fixed index annuities, your money earns interest based on any positive changes to an external index, such as the SP 500, over a set period of time. If the index goes up, you receive a portion of the upside. If the index falls, your contract valueincluding any interest youve earned in the pastis not affected.
Indexed annuities are safe investment options that can provide lifetime income and protection from inflation. The main appeal of these annuities is that they offer the potential for higher returns than traditional fixed annuities without the risk of loss of principal.
You Can Lose Money While indexed annuities are considered more conservative than variable annuitiesand make a selling point of their guaranteed returnthey nonetheless carry risks. One is if you need to get out of the contract early because of a financial emergency or other pressing need.
An index term period is the length of time during which your annuitys interest rate is based on the performance of a particular index. The most popular indexes used in fixed indexed annuities are the SP 500 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average. Index term periods typically range from one to ten years.
In general, gains (or earnings) which are withdrawn from fixed index or multi-year annuities are taxed as ordinary income, not as capital gains. If your annuity is invested with qualified funds, such as monies rolled over from a 401k or IRA, then the full amount withdrawn will be subject to ordinary income tax.
